At first glance, it seemed like Wanaka was one of those resort towns with more motels, bars and estate agents than people living there. Driving around the town at 11pm looking for somewhere to buy goods, I was left wanting, but I did discover that there is in fact plenty of suburbia surrounding central Wanaka.

Half-finished houses prove that plenty of people are jumping on the bandwagon, and if I were to come across a big wad of cash anytime soon I would probably join in.

This morning we survived the short but perilous journey from Wanaka to Queenstown, bypassing the more solid Cromwell route in favour of the more scenic mountain road. Truly, we have entered snow country. And it’s full of Aussies.
